WHEN THE BLEEDING STOPS
May 23, 2026
When the Bleeding Stops is a performance work in which Lovísa Ósk Gunnarsdóttir addresses the silence and taboo that seems to engulf menopause in Western society, as well as her personal experience of aging as a dancer.
After suffering an injury five years ago, Lovísa was forced to reconsider her relationship with dance and the body. This process opened her eyes to the silence around menopause and her own lack of knowledge on the subject. She began researching, and posted an open invitation online calling on menopausal women to participate in her project. Before she knew it, she was working with a large number of women from across Icelandic society.
The work has been presented at major festivals like Julidans (Amsterdam) and Tanz im August (Berlin).
The work was selected by Aerowaves in 2023
